As a seller on ebay, I love it when people bid on my items early and often.  

As a buyer on ebay, I have absolutely no clue why anyone does that.  Really, what's the point.  I think every auction I've ever bid on before the final seconds I have lost.  Someone always snipes it and that is exactly how I prefer to buy, bidding early only when I won't be around when an auction ends.  

I think han will go for $3300 or so.  Vlix may not go, that's a lot of money for a loose figure.  I am aware of the rarity, of course, but I'd think that would fit as a last second buy as well.
